I am a woman therefore my two pence is that if you are still bearing children and your finances are not favourable, stop and reassess yourself.
Look into what you can do on a small scale.. consider multiple streams of income. Partnership ? Empower yourself.
Looking for pity, dragging your spouse with family or online will not work. Cry in your closet and come out smart. You don't need pity. You need action.
Sit yourself down, plan and restrategies.
Love will not pay school fees or put food on the table. The well-being of yourself and your children is your priority and leave the man be. If he is not paying child maintenance, you go to court, not social media.
